14:22 — Offline sync regression confirmed (Terrapath field-survey app)

At 14:22 the on-call engineer reproduced the data-loss path: surveys saved while offline were marked synced once connectivity returned, even when the upload was rejected. The queue flush skipped the server acknowledgement check introduced in the previous sprint. Release manager note: the fix must ship before the coastal survey season. The offending build is identified by the token recorded below.

session token of kawif-fawig = htk31_f3f599be2b1a34affb1efa8d0feccf8

## Tuning Soft Deletes

The `orders` table in Pelterow uses soft deletes: rows get a `deleted_at` timestamp and are purged later by a background sweeper. Purging too aggressively breaks refund lookups; too lazily, and the table bloats and index scans slow down. Adjust the sweeper cadence and retention window together, and always test changes against a restored production snapshot first. The current sweeper settings are shown below.

tuning table, faduf-baduf:
PRIORITIES = {
    "ulavan": 191,
    "silys": 750,
    "goriel": 238,
    "kelmir": 66,
    "wendor": 432,
}

## Read-Replica Lag Alarm

New folks: the ReplicaLagHigh alarm covers the Ostrel reporting replicas. It fires when lag exceeds 90 seconds for five minutes. Most triggers come from the nightly Bramwell export job, which is expected and auto-resolves. Do not fail over the replica yourself — that requires the data-platform lead's approval and a change ticket. If the alarm persists past 20 minutes with no export running, write to the platform inbox.

billing contact of yahip-yadup = eliax.druix@zemvarworks.corp

# Break-Glass: Catalog Cache Invalidation

Scope: the Pinrow product catalog at Veldstone Retail. If stale prices persist after a purge and the Hollowmere invalidation queue is wedged, use break-glass to flush the edge tier directly. Contractors: get verbal sign-off from the catalog lead first. Steps: open the Hollowmere admin shell, select emergency-flush, confirm the tenant, and run it once — repeated flushes thrash the origin. Access is logged and expires after 20 minutes. Unseal the admin shell with the passphrase below.

recovery phrase for kahop-tajog: istix-casvan